Gordon Research Conference: Tissue Niches & Resident Stem Cells in Adult Epithelia
The Hong Kong University of Science and Technology 7-12 August 2016
The GRC "Tissue Niches and Resident Stem Cells in Adult Epithelia” will focus on comparative principles of adult epithelial stem cell dynamics and niche signaling in the homeostasis of different tissues. This conference will include work on the molecular control of stem cell function from the epidermis and its appendages, intestine, lung, mammary gland, cornea and retina, epithelial transition zones, and emerging work from other epithelial tissues. All model organisms are welcome. We strongly believe in being inclusive, and hope to inspire a principle of alternating speakers that will allow a variety of participants to contribute to this exciting meeting over the coming years.

The Stem Cell Niche 2016
Favrholm Campus, Hillerød, Denmark 22-26 May 2016
The aim of the conference is to provide a niche for presentations of the latest basic research in stem cell and developmental biology and to stimulate exchange of ideas by providing ample time for both formal and informal discussions. The conference theme is the concept of the “niche”, in the broadest possible sense of the word, encompassing all sources of inputs stem and progenitor cells receive from their environment to expand or differentiate.

Cell Signaling in Cancer: from Mechanisms to Therapy
Snowmass Village, CO, USA 5-10 June 2016
This SRC focuses on understanding the molecular and cellular mechanisms of signaling in cancer in order to develop effective therapies. Specifically, the driving force behind this meeting is that understanding cancer at the molecular and cellular level opens the arena for novel therapeutic strategies. The meeting will cover cancer from the biochemical to the therapeutic level.
International Society for Cellular Therapy
Singapore, Singapore 25-28 May 2016
ISCT, formed in 1992 is a global society of clinicians, regulators, technologists, and industry partners with a shared vision to translate cellular therapy into safe and effective therapies to improve patients’ lives. ISCT offers a unique collaboration between academia, regulatory bodies, and industry partners in cell therapy translation.
